Scientists compared the panda skulls from past and present
The giant panda’s earliest known ancestor was much smaller than its modern-day counterpart, scientists say.
A fossilised skull found in south China revealed the ancient animal, known as Ailuropoda microta, was about half the size of today’s giant panda.
